Bloom Time: Varies, with the most common types, wax and tuberous begonias, blooming from early summer … WebMar 25, 2024 · In autumn, dig up tuberous begonias and store the tubers in a cool, frost-free spot for winter. Bring fibrous-rooted types indoors over winter, or treat as annuals and throw on the compost heap. Foliage begonias are grown as house plants but can enjoy time outdoors in summer.
